    Floxed
    In genetics, floxed is used to describe the sandwiching of a DNA sequence between two lox P sites,and is a contraction of the phrase "flanked by LoxP". Recombination between LoxP sites is catalysed by Cre recombinase. Floxing a gene allows it to be deleted , translocated or inverted.Floxed genes...
